Pindari Glacier Trek – Kumaon’s Hidden Himalayan Giant
-
Trek Distance: ~45 km
-
Base Village: Loharkhet / Khati
-
Difficulty: Moderate
-
Best for: October & early November
This trail takes you through dense pine and rhododendron forests, remote Himalayan villages, and vast alpine meadows before reaching the majestic Pindari Glacier. Autumn offers clear views of surrounding peaks and golden forest landscapes, making it a paradise for nature lovers.

Kedarkantha Trek – Beyond the Crowds in Autumn
-
Trek Distance: ~20 km
-
Starting Point: Sankri
-
Difficulty: Moderate
-
Why Autumn: Clear skies & fewer trekkers
The trek passes through the Govind Pashu Vihar National Park, showcasing autumn forests, charming villages, and expansive meadows. Summit views of Swargarohini and Bandarpoonch are stunning during this season.

Kanasar Lake Trek – A True Offbeat Forest Escape
-
Trek Distance: ~16 km
-
Region: Near Sankri
-
Difficulty: Easy to Moderate
The trail winds through ancient deodar forests, open meadows, and rhododendron groves before reaching the tranquil lake. In October and November, the forest colors and cool air create an incredibly peaceful trekking experience.

Adi Kailash Trek – Spiritual & Remote Himalayan Journey
-
Trek Distance: ~40 km
-
Starting Point: Dharchula
-
Difficulty: Challenging
-
Best Time: September–October
Often called Chhota Kailash, this trek takes you through rugged terrain, high-altitude villages, and dramatic mountain landscapes. October is ideal before heavy snowfall begins, offering clear views of Om Parvat.

Nachiketa Tal Trek – Easy & Serene Autumn Trek
-
Trek Distance: ~12 km
-
Region: Uttarkashi
-
Difficulty: Easy
Surrounded by forests and Himalayan views, Nachiketa Tal is perfect for autumn camping and meditation. October and November offer pleasant weather and clear night skies.

Essential Tips for Autumn Trekking in Uttarakhand
-
Carry warm layers—nights get cold
-
Start early to avoid fog in valleys
-
Hire local guides for remote routes
-
Check weather forecasts regularly
-
Avoid late November for very high-altitude treks
